rakeller Posted September 16, 2024 at 06:10 PM Share Posted September 16, 2024 at 06:10 PM Bei meinem Kostal Plenticore ist der Gridmeter direkt via Modbus angeschlossen, als Sunspec Meter [203]. Die Leistung in W kann ich korrekt auslesen, doch wird Enery draw bzw. Energy feed zu klein angezeigt (0.969 kWh anstatt 969 kWh). Ist dieses Problem bekannt? Besten Dank! - Ralph Quote Link to comment Share on other sites More sharing options...
MatzeTF Posted September 17, 2024 at 01:18 PM Share Posted September 17, 2024 at 01:18 PM Wir haben hier ein KOSTAL Smart Energy Meter im Einsatz. Das verwendet auch das SunSpec Model 203 und zeigt Energiebezug und -einspeisung korrekt an, dementsprechend ist is kein Problem auf Wallboxseite. Bei KOSTAL haben nicht nur wir sondern auch andere Anbieter festgestellt, dass sie es mit der SunSpec-Spezifikation nicht so genau nehmen. Beispielsweise sind alle Energiewerte, die laut Spezifikation vorzeichenlos sein sollten, bei allen KOSTAL-Geräten vorzeichenbehaftet. Es würde mich nicht wundern, wenn die Energiewerte, die laut Spezifikation in Wattstunden angegeben werden sollen, beim PLENTICORE einfach mal als Kilowattstunden ausgegeben werden und somit um den Faktor 1000 zu klein sind. Wenn du weißt, wie du bei deinem Router eine Portweiterleitung für den Modbus-Port deines Wechselrichters anlegst, kannst du das mal machen und mir vormittags deine IP des Tages™ per privater Nachricht schicken. Dann kann ich mir mal die Rohwerte deines Wechselrichters ansehen. Ich vermute ganz stark, dass die einfach falsch sind. Quote Link to comment Share on other sites More sharing options...
rakeller Posted September 19, 2024 at 07:44 PM Author Share Posted September 19, 2024 at 07:44 PM Tatsaechlich, wenn ich die Register per Modbus direkt auslesen, dann sind die Werte in kWh anstatt Wh: mbpoll kostal.home -a 71 -p 1502 -m tcp -r 40347 -t 4:int -1 -B Data type.............: 32-bit integer (big endian), output (holding) register table -- Polling slave 71... [40347]: 2265 <=== 2.265 kWh mbpoll kostal.home -a 71 -p 1502 -m tcp -r 40355 -t 4:int -1 -B Data type.............: 32-bit integer (big endian), output (holding) register table -- Polling slave 71... [40355]: 1028 <==== 1.028 kWh (sollte aber in Wh sein) Habt Ihr schon versucht, dies KOSTAL mitzuteilen? Quote Link to comment Share on other sites More sharing options...
rakeller Posted September 19, 2024 at 08:03 PM Author Share Posted September 19, 2024 at 08:03 PM Es gibt in der Sunspec noch einen Skalierfaktor, doch wenn ich diesen auslese (Start 55) bekomme ich 0: mbpoll kostal.home -a 71 -p 1502 -m tcp -r 40363 -t 4 -1 -B Data type.............: 16-bit register, output (holding) register table -- Polling slave 71... [40363]: 0 Quote Link to comment Share on other sites More sharing options...
MatzeTF Posted September 19, 2024 at 09:42 PM Share Posted September 19, 2024 at 09:42 PM Die 0 steht für 10^0, also ein Skalierfaktor von 1. Das passt zum falschen Wert. Ich hoffe, du hast Verständnis dafür, dass wir nicht allen Bugs anderer Hersteller hinterherlaufen können, insbesondere wenn es sich um ein eher kosmetisches Problem handelt. Wir haben aktuell eine Anfrage bei einem anderen Hersteller am laufen, dessen SunSpec-Daten noch viel schlimmer verbuggt sind, und das entwickelt sich zum reinsten Zeitgrab. Da du selbst das KOSTAL-Gerät im Einsatz hast, kannst du dich an KOSTAL wenden und ihnen deine Erkenntnisse von den selbst ausgelesenen Registern mitteilen, damit sie nicht versuchen, die Schuld auf uns abzuwälzen. Hast du ansonsten schon mal nach einem Firmware-Update für den KOSTAL-Zähler geschaut? Ich glaube es zwar nicht, aber vielleicht ist das Problem schon repariert? Quote Link to comment Share on other sites More sharing options...
rakeller Posted September 20, 2024 at 01:43 PM Author Share Posted September 20, 2024 at 01:43 PM Besten Dank fuer die Infos, ja der Skalierfaktor 10^0 = 1 ist definitiv falsch und somit ist es ein Fehler der Kostal Plenticore Firmware. Ich kann dies gerne melden -- gibts dafuer einen Kontakt? Ansonsten versuche ich einen Ansprechpartner zu finden. Als Grid-Zaehler verwende ist einen Eastron SDM-630, welcher direkt (per Kabel via Modbus) mit dem Kostal Wechselricher verbunden ist. Ich habe verschiedene dieser Zaehler und wenn ich diese auslesen per Modbus (und in Openhab anzeige), sind die Verbrauchswerte jeweils korrekt.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.